• jQuery(三)


    一、设置元素样式

          添加、删除css类别

          $("div").addClass("myClass1 myClass2");

          $("div").removeClass("myClass1");

          类别间动态切换

          $(function(){

              $(''p").click(function(){

                 $(this).toggleClass("hihglight");//点击时不断切换

                })

             })

          说明:toggleClass只能设置一种Class不能设置多个。

       

        ●直接获取、设置样式

          $("p").mouseover(function(){

            $(this).css("color","red");

          })

          $("P")mouseout(function(){

            $("p").css("color","black");

           })

        某个元素中是否含有某个css类别,返回为布尔型

         $("li:last").hasClass("myClass");

        ●直接获取、编辑内容

         html(text)

         text(content)

         $("p").click(function(){

         var sHtmlStr=$(this).html();

         $(this).text(sHtmlStr);

         })

        ●移动和复制元素

         $("P").append("<b>直接添加</b>");// 给所有p标记添加一段html代码作为子元素

         

         $("P:eq(1)").append($("a:eq(1)"));//第二个P后面添加第二个a作为它的子元素

      

         $("img:eq(1)").appendTo("p:eq(0)"); 

         $("P:eq(1)").after($("a:eq(1)"));// 第二个p后面添加第二个a

      

       ●删除元素

        $("p:contains(‘大’)").remove();

        $("p").empty();//清除p里面的内容

        处里表单里面的值

         val()

         val(text)

       ●绑定事件监听

         bild

       

         one方法  绑定事件触发一次后自动删除

         $("P").unbild("click");移除绑定

      

        ●交替

          见demo

        ●鼠标感应

          见demo

  • 相关阅读:
    作业八
    作业七:用户体验设计案例分析
    作业六。合作编程
    作业五:需求分析
    作业四:结对编程2
    作业四:合作
    作业三:词频统计
    学习进度表
    java程序练习
    简单博客练习
  • 原文地址:https://www.cnblogs.com/screen2015/p/5143654.html
Copyright © 2020-2023  润新知